IND vs SA: Stats ahead of third Test

Let's take a look at some of the numbers and stats ahead of the third Test between India and South Africa, scheduled to start on Wednesday at the Wanderers.

South Africa won its last Test at this venue against Sri Lanka in January 2017, but has not won back to back games there since 2002-2003 (W5, D1 L6 since).

South Africa has won consecutive Tests against India for the first time since 2006/07, it has not won three in a row against Kohli's men since 2000-2001.

The Proteas have never beaten India in a Test at Wanderers Stadium in Johannesburg (D3, L1).

Vernon Philander is in line to play his 50th Test match, he is one of just two South African players with averages above and below 24 for batting and bowling respectively (10+ matches & 10+ wickets, also Shaun Pollock)

Cheteshwar Pujara hit 153 in India’s second innings the last time it played at this venue, the highest score by an India batsman there, in fact the highest 2nd innings score by an Indian batsman in South Africa.
